Transaction a89c63c1003c58d2ec39883103a7f4e7e0509ec488ac694062564000067c5a0e
1 Input
1 Output
-
a89c63c1003c58d2ec39883103a7f4e7e0509ec488ac694062564000067c5a0e:0
- value
- 1626460
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38dff82d17850e10b4e000b1971d02fa5697b91e OP_EQUALVERIFY OP_CHECKSIG
- address
- 16Bj9QtYSwU5ZaAMeMXBzLzUiVL6oGBXQ5